Abstract 
Gauguin created his own journal "Le Sourire" in 1899, during his stays between Tahiti and the island of Hiva Oa (Marquesas Islands). It was self-published - handwritten and handprinted. Originally conceived as weekly, it was published monthly. It is thought that not more than thirty copies were produced at a time.
See L. J. Bouge, 'Le Sourire' de Paul Gauguin. Collection complète en fac-simile, Paris, 1952.
